黑狐家游戏

支持大数据的重要技术有哪些,揭秘大数据时代,支持大数据的重要技术解析

欧气 1 0

本文目录导读:

  1. 大数据的定义与特点
  2. 支持大数据的重要技术

大数据的定义与特点

大数据(Big Data)是指无法用传统数据处理应用软件工具进行捕捉、管理和处理的数据集合,这些数据集合具有海量的数据规模、快速的数据流转、多样的数据类型和价值密度低四大特点。

支持大数据的重要技术

1、分布式存储技术

随着数据量的不断增长,分布式存储技术应运而生,它可以将海量数据分散存储在多个节点上,提高数据存储的可靠性和扩展性,常见的分布式存储技术有:

支持大数据的重要技术有哪些,揭秘大数据时代,支持大数据的重要技术解析

图片来源于网络,如有侵权联系删除

(1)Hadoop HDFS:Hadoop分布式文件系统(Hadoop Distributed File System,简称HDFS)是Apache Hadoop项目的一部分,用于存储大量数据,HDFS采用主从架构,主节点(NameNode)负责元数据的管理,从节点(DataNode)负责存储数据。

(2)Ceph:Ceph是一个开源的分布式存储系统,具有高可用性、高性能和可扩展性等特点,Ceph支持多种存储类型,如对象存储、块存储和文件存储。

2、分布式计算技术

分布式计算技术可以将大数据处理任务分配到多个节点上并行执行,提高计算效率,常见的分布式计算技术有:

(1)MapReduce:MapReduce是Hadoop的核心计算框架,用于大规模数据处理,它将计算任务分解为Map和Reduce两个阶段,分别处理和合并数据。

(2)Spark:Apache Spark是一个开源的分布式计算系统,支持多种编程语言,如Java、Scala和Python,Spark采用弹性分布式数据集(RDD)作为其数据抽象,支持快速迭代计算。

3、数据挖掘与分析技术

支持大数据的重要技术有哪些,揭秘大数据时代,支持大数据的重要技术解析

图片来源于网络,如有侵权联系删除

数据挖掘与分析技术可以从海量数据中提取有价值的信息,为决策提供支持,常见的数据挖掘与分析技术有:

(1)机器学习:机器学习是一种通过算法和统计模型自动从数据中学习规律的技术,常见的机器学习算法有决策树、支持向量机、聚类等。

(2)统计分析:统计分析是通过对数据进行分析和建模,揭示数据之间的内在联系和规律,常见的统计分析方法有描述性统计、推断性统计等。

4、数据可视化技术

数据可视化技术可以将复杂的数据以图形化的方式呈现,便于用户理解数据背后的信息,常见的数据可视化技术有:

(1)ECharts:ECharts是一个开源的数据可视化库,支持多种图表类型,如折线图、柱状图、饼图等。

(2)D3.js:D3.js是一个基于Web的JavaScript库,用于数据可视化,它支持丰富的图表类型和交互功能。

支持大数据的重要技术有哪些,揭秘大数据时代,支持大数据的重要技术解析

图片来源于网络,如有侵权联系删除

5、云计算技术

云计算技术可以将大数据处理任务部署在云端,实现弹性扩展和资源共享,常见的云计算技术有:

(1)阿里云:阿里云是国内领先的云计算服务商,提供包括弹性计算、存储、数据库、大数据处理等在内的全方位云计算服务。

(2)腾讯云:腾讯云是腾讯公司旗下的云计算品牌,提供丰富的云计算产品和服务。

随着大数据时代的到来,支持大数据的重要技术也在不断发展和完善,以上介绍的分布式存储、分布式计算、数据挖掘与分析、数据可视化以及云计算等技术,为大数据处理和应用提供了有力支持,在未来,这些技术将继续推动大数据产业的发展,为各行各业带来更多价值。

标签: #支持大数据的重要技术

黑狐家游戏
  • 评论列表

留言评论